Read MoreThe razor saw can be used for straight cuts, veneers, and some joins. Make sure your razor saw has a deep enough blade to fit into your chosen miter box. Used with a block of wood to limit length, the miter box combined with a razor saw can cut several pieces of wood to the same length, which is useful for making things like miniature table legs.

Read MoreThis smaller board goes to the bottom of the bookcase. Step 1: Cut the dado slots. The first thing you will be working on are the two upright boards. Cut dado slots measuring ¾ inch wide and ¼ inch deep. These are where the widths of the shelves are going to go in later, and the purpose of the dadoes are to make the shelves stand in the wood.

Read MoreWhen you find a spot you like for the shelves, use a stud finder to make sure the studs are at least 14-1/2 inches apart. Before you cut the big hole, cut a small inspection hole. Use a compact mirror and flashlight to peek inside the wall. Look for pipes, wires or other obstructions.

Read MoreTo create a long shelf on either and inward- or outward-curved wall, make a continuous floating crescent from plywood. Simply use the traditional method of scribing -- using a compass or dividers to simultaneously trace the curve of the wall and mark it on a scrap of cardboard -- to make a cutting template..
